The moment draws near

Written by Angeline Fu

How is it that I can feel excited and yet anxious and worried at the same time?
... Excited because R and co are doing the summit push on Tuesday - its been a long journey with sacrifices physically, mentally, emotionally, financially for them to get to this stage and the peak is just before them! Almost there!

... Worried and anxious because there are just so many unknowns, the effects of altitude on their bodies, the snow, the draining physical demands being that high up and exerting themselves climbing to the top.

Everyone are so proud of them, R & co have gone higher than any one of them have gone before. We on the sea level are tether hooks, sending their prayers and thoughts to them, cheering them on wishing them good weather, good health, successful summit and safe descent...

Baby steps, Rob, Greg and Marco, baby steps, one step at a time... and you'll be there... May the Turquoise Goddess smile on you and welcome your ascent!

And remember to keep the baby steps when you come back to London, R... then at least I can wear my stilettos and not have to trot behind you - finally we could be even walking together even paced!
